Job Qualifications
  • Advanced Degree In Bioinformatics, Computer Science, Or A Related Field

  • Minimum Of 5 Years Of Experience In A Bioinformatics Or Computational Biology Role

  • Strong Understanding Of Genomics And Molecular Biology Principles

  • Proficiency In Programming Languages And Bioinformatics Software, Such As R, Python, And Unix

  • Experience Managing And Mentoring A Team Of Bioinformatics Scientists

Compensation

According to JobzMall, the average salary range for a Senior/Lead Bioinformatics Scientist is $118,000 - $160,000 per year. However, this can vary depending on factors such as location, company, and level of experience. Some senior/lead bioinformatics scientists may earn upwards of $200,000 per year.

About Natera

Natera is a genetic testing company that operates a CLIA-certified laboratory in San Carlos, California.
